Skype call with students from St Clair School, Dunedin


The students from the
Super 7 Scoopers Blog, St Clair School in Dunedin, have been wanting to talk to some of our students about their experiences during and after the big 7.1 earthquake.

So, today we had a Skype video conference to meet and chat with them.
Three of their Year 6 students interviewed four of our Year 8 students (Emma-Rose, Georgia, Lucy, Courtney). They had some interesting questions, and were amazed at our stories. No doubt you'll be able to read what they thought in a post on their blog coming up soon!

Peter and the Wolf

For Term 4 we are doing 'Let your imagination run wild' and the main part is based on The Arts. As dance is an art Mrs Watson (Room 8 teacher) has decided to run a Production called 'Peter and the Wolf'. Peter and the Wolf is an original classic written by Sergei Prokofiev in 1936. Because there is no speaking in this play each character is represented by a different musical instrument.
